T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model belongs to the technical field of reaction kettle test frock, concretely relates to a reaction kettle heat medium test system. BACKGROUND

[0002] Reaction kettle is the production equipment commonly used in chemical industry, medicine and other fields, and has wide application range. One of the characteristics of the production equipment is integration of various equipment and fixation. Reaction kettle is one part of the production equipment. Therefore, the quality requirement of reaction kettle is high, and the reaction kettle should not be deformed and leak at normal working temperature.

[0003] In order to ensure the welding quality of the reaction kettle and the heat medium pipeline of the reaction kettle, quality detection is needed before leaving the factory. In addition to the conventional quality detection, simulation detection of working conditions is also needed to ensure the welding quality.

[0004] However, the existing test equipment can only heat the heat medium, and cannot cool the heat medium. Therefore, the reaction kettle can only be simulated under general working conditions by the heat medium, and the welding position of the reaction kettle cannot be tested under high and low temperature alternating stress. The welding quality of the reaction kettle under severe working conditions cannot be detected. UTILITY MODEL CONTENTS

[0005] The utility model solves the technical problem that the existing test equipment cannot simulate high and low temperature alternation, and the welding position of the reaction kettle and the heat medium pipeline cannot be detected under severe working conditions.

[0049] Embodiment

[0050] As shown in Fig. 1 , Fig. 2 and Fig. 3 , the reaction kettle heat medium test system provided by the present application comprises:

[0051] Low tank 1, the low tank 1 is arranged on the ground, and the low tank 1 is used for containing heat medium;

[0052] The high-level tank 2 is located above the low-level tank 1 and is generally fixed in mid-air by a fixed bracket, so that the heat medium can flow down automatically by gravity. The high-level tank 2 and the low-level tank 1 are connected by a first conveying pipe 4, and an oil pump 41 is installed in the first conveying pipe 4, which serves as the power source for the circulation of the heat medium. The low-level tank 1 and the high-level tank 2 are also equipped with level gauges 26 to observe the amount of heat medium stored inside.

[0053] Mold temperature controller 3, the mold temperature controller 3 is installed on the ground, and a second conveying pipe 5 is provided between the mold temperature controller 3 and the high-level tank 2;

[0054] The mold temperature controller 3 is also provided with a third conveying pipe 6 for connecting to the reactor inlet 8, and the reactor outlet 9 is also provided with a fourth conveying pipe 7;

[0055] Both the third conveying pipeline 6 and the fourth conveying pipeline 7 are equipped with heat exchangers 27. The heat exchangers 27 can be finned tubes, plate heat exchangers, or shell-and-tube heat exchangers, etc., and the heat medium is cooled down by air cooling or water cooling.

[0056] This invention utilizes a mold temperature controller 3 to circulate and heat the heat medium, and a heat exchanger 27 to circulate and cool the heat medium. The mold temperature controller 3 and the heat exchanger 27 are used alternately, allowing the heat medium to be repeatedly heated and cooled. This subjects the reactor and heat medium pipelines to alternating stresses at different temperatures in a short period of time, simulating harsh working conditions and maximizing the testing of the welding strength of the reactor and heat medium pipelines. In addition, a large amount of heat medium is stored in the low-level tank, while in the actual heat medium testing process, the heat medium is sent to the high-level tank, which participates in the heat medium circulation. The high-level tank acts as a buffer, accommodating heat medium pipelines of reactors with different volumes, and allowing the inlet of the mold temperature controller 3 to draw sufficient heat medium (without the high-level tank 2, the long pipeline would affect the heat medium drawn from the inlet of the mold temperature controller 3, and the drawn heat medium might contain air, affecting the service life of the oil pump inside the mold temperature controller 3).

[0057] Based on the above technical solution, the fourth conveying pipeline 7 is also provided with two parallel branch pipes 71, and the branch pipes 71 are provided with a filter 20 and a pressure gauge 19. The pressure gauge 19 is a commonly used pressure testing instrument.

[0058] The fourth conveying pipeline 7 is also provided with a temporary vent pipe 10 to the high-level tank 2. The temporary vent pipe 10 is mainly used to replace the reactor under test and send the heat medium flowing through the reactor into the high-level tank 2.

[0059] Due to the welding slag and other impurities possibly existing in the heat medium pipeline, the heat medium needs to be filtered by the filter 20 to avoid damaging the mold temperature machine 3. As for the two branch pipes 71, they are used alternately, when the filter 20 of one of the branch pipes 71 needs to be cleaned, the other branch pipe 71 is used for the circulation of the heat medium.

[0060] On the basis of the above technical scheme, the mold temperature machine 3 and the fourth conveying pipeline 7 are both provided with a first return pipeline 11 to the low-position tank 1, and the reaction kettle is also provided with a second return pipeline 12 connected to the first return pipeline 11;

[0061] The high-position tank 2 is also provided with an overflow pipeline 13 to the low-position tank 1, and the high-position tank 2 is further provided with an emergency discharge port connected to the overflow pipeline 13.

[0062] The first return pipeline 11 and the second return pipeline 12 are both used to return the heat medium to the low-position tank 1 for pressure relief because the volume of the heat medium expands after being heated (the heat medium is gradually heated), and too much heat medium will cause excessive pressure in the mold temperature machine 3 and the reaction kettle. Similarly, the overflow pipeline 13 also has the same effect, which protects the pipeline and the high-position tank 2.

[0063] On the basis of the above technical scheme, the first conveying pipeline 4 is provided with an inlet 42 at the front end of the oil pump 41 and an outlet 43 at the rear end of the oil pump 41.

[0064] The inlet 42 and the outlet 43 are both provided with valve bodies. The valve bodies are arranged on the pipeline for the purpose of cutoff and the like, which is a conventional technology and will not be described in detail.

[0065] The inlet 42 is used to draw the heat medium from an external heat medium storage container by the oil pump 41 when the system is initially used. Conversely, when the system needs to be cleaned or repaired, the heat medium in the system is discharged to the external heat medium storage container through the outlet 43. The oil pump 41 is used to complete the filling and discharge of the heat medium, which speeds up the efficiency and does not require manual operation or additional power source.

[0066] On the basis of the above technical scheme, the low-position tank 1 is provided with a first exhaust pipeline 14.

[0067] The high-position tank 2 is provided with a second exhaust pipeline 15, and the second exhaust pipeline 15 is further provided with a tail gas treatment device.

[0068] The tail gas treatment device comprises a water cooling tank 16, an adsorption tank 17 and a flame arrester 18 connected in sequence.

[0069] After the low tank 1 is filled with the heat medium, the internal air needs to be discharged through the first exhaust pipe 14, and the heat medium fume generated after the heat medium in the high tank 2 is heated needs to be discharged through the second exhaust pipe 15, but the heat medium fume will pollute the environment, so the water cooling tank 16 is needed to cool and liquefy the heat medium fume, and the fume that cannot be completely liquefied will enter the adsorption tank 17 and be adsorbed by the graphite in the adsorption tank 17; the flame arrester 18 plays a protective effect to prevent the pipeline from catching fire.

[0070] On the basis of the above technical scheme, further comprising:

[0071] The nitrogen sealing pipe is divided into a first nitrogen sealing pipe 21 and a second nitrogen sealing pipe 22, the first nitrogen sealing pipe 21 is communicated with the low tank 1, and the second nitrogen sealing pipe 22 is communicated with the high tank 2;

[0072] The reaction kettle gas return pipe 23 is communicated with the high tank 2, and the heat medium fume generated after the heat medium in the heat medium pipeline of the reaction kettle is heated needs to be discharged into the high tank 2;

[0073] The nitrogen purging pipe 24 is communicated with the reaction kettle gas return pipe 23, and the nitrogen purging pipe 24 is further provided with a sampling branch pipe 241, from which a gas sample can be taken out and used for analyzing the internal gas components;

[0074] The nitrogen flow rate in the nitrogen purging pipe 24 is faster than the heat medium fume flow rate in the reaction kettle gas return pipe 23, so that the heat medium fume can be driven to flow to the high tank 2;

[0075] The high tank 2 and the mold temperature controller 3 are further provided with a fume backflow pipe 25, which is also used for inputting the heat medium fume generated after the heat medium is heated into the high tank 2.

[0076] In order to facilitate the flow of the heat medium in the low tank 1 and the high tank 2 and maintain the internal pressure, nitrogen with a certain pressure needs to be introduced into the interior through the nitrogen sealing pipe; and the nitrogen purging pipe 24 can use nitrogen to bring the residual heat medium fume, heat medium liquid and the like in the pipeline into the high tank 2.
